Market Snapshot: Acoustic Sensors Market Size and Outlook
The acoustic sensors market is tracking robust growth, advancing from USD 1.59 billion in 2024 to USD 1.79 billion in 2025. Forecasts place the market at USD 4.25 billion by 2032, reflecting a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of 13.08%. This expansion is driven by widespread adoption in automotive, healthcare, consumer electronics, and industrial monitoring sectors. Each sector leverages acoustic sensors to enhance digital transformation efforts, boost safety, and enable real-time data monitoring, highlighting the broad applicability and strategic importance of these technologies.
Scope & Segmentation: Comprehensive View of Acoustic Sensors Market Structure
- Type: Includes Acoustic Emission Sensors such as Resonant and Wideband Sensors, Hydrophones for both High and Low Frequency applications, Microphones spanning Condenser, Dynamic, and MemS types, Sonar Sensors offered in Multi Beam and Single Beam variants, and Ultrasonic Sensors covering Distance, Level, and Proximity measurements.
- Technology: Features Analog and Digital approaches, MemS including Capacitive and Piezoelectric MemS, and Piezoelectric options with Ceramic and Crystal configurations, addressing diverse sensing needs and scalability for various industries.
- End Use: Key areas of deployment span Automotive (inclusive of Collision Detection, Infotainment, and Parking Assistance systems), Consumer Electronics (covering Smart Home Devices, Smartphones, and Wearables), Healthcare (supporting Hearing Aids, Patient Monitoring, and Telehealth), Industrial solutions (including Environmental, Machine Condition, and Process Monitoring), and Military and Defense (focusing on Communication, Sonar, and Surveillance systems).
- Application: Addresses Leak Detection for pipeline and tank monitoring, Non Destructive Testing such as flaw or weld inspection, Structural Health Monitoring in assets like bridges and dams, Underwater Exploration (maritime surveys and underwater communication), and Voice Recognition for smart speakers and virtual assistants.
- Region: Coverage spans the Americas (notably the United States, Canada, Mexico, Brazil, Argentina, Chile, Colombia, Peru), Europe, Middle East & Africa (with the United Kingdom, Germany, France, Russia, Italy, Spain, Netherlands, Sweden, Poland, Switzerland, United Arab Emirates, Saudi Arabia, Qatar, Turkey, Israel, South Africa, Nigeria, Egypt, Kenya), and Asia-Pacific (including China, India, Japan, Australia, South Korea, Indonesia, Thailand, Malaysia, Singapore, Taiwan), each presenting varied demand drivers and regulatory landscapes.
- Tier One Companies: Major industry players include Knowles Corporation, Goertek Inc., AAC Technologies Holdings Inc., Cirrus Logic, Inc., STMicroelectronics N.V., Infineon Technologies AG, Analog Devices, Inc., TDK Corporation, Robert Bosch GmbH, and Pepperl+Fuchs GmbH.
Key Takeaways: Strategic Insights for Decision-Makers
- Acoustic sensors support next-generation functionality, helping industries prioritize operational safety, enhanced performance, and actionable real-time analytics.
- Emerging shifts in the global supply chain are encouraging manufacturers to diversify sourcing strategies and capitalize on regional production hubs for resilience.
- Collaboration with materials science and software partners optimizes time-to-market and provides routes for targeted product customization to meet specific industry standards.
- Continuous advancements in MEMS fabrication and piezoelectric materials are promoting miniaturization and greater sensitivity, making acoustic sensor deployment feasible in challenging and sensitive environments.
- The increased need for cloud-enabled predictive analytics, especially in machine condition monitoring and structural health, is guiding long-term product development priorities and innovation strategies.
